首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

服务器的数据库密码怎么查看

服务器的数据库密码是保存在数据库管理系统中的,具体的查看方法取决于使用的数据库管理系统的类型。以下是几种常见的数据库管理系统及其查看密码的方法:

  1. MySQL:
    • 登录到服务器的命令行终端或通过SSH连接到服务器。
    • 运行以下命令查看MySQL的root用户密码:sudo cat /etc/mysql/debian.cnf
    • 在输出中找到[client]部分,其中包含userpassword字段,password字段即为MySQL的root用户密码。
  2. PostgreSQL:
    • 登录到服务器的命令行终端或通过SSH连接到服务器。
    • 运行以下命令查看PostgreSQL的密码:sudo cat /etc/postgresql/{版本号}/main/pg_hba.conf其中,{版本号}是PostgreSQL的版本号,例如12
    • 在输出中找到包含md5password的行,该行的密码字段即为PostgreSQL的密码。
  3. MongoDB:
    • 登录到服务器的命令行终端或通过SSH连接到服务器。
    • 运行以下命令连接到MongoDB的shell:mongo
    • 运行以下命令切换到admin数据库:use admin
    • 运行以下命令查看MongoDB的密码:db.auth('admin', '密码')其中,密码是MongoDB的密码。
  4. Oracle Database:
    • 登录到服务器的命令行终端或通过SSH连接到服务器。
    • 运行以下命令查看Oracle Database的密码:sudo cat /opt/oracle/product/{版本号}/dbhome_1/network/admin/tnsnames.ora其中,{版本号}是Oracle Database的版本号,例如12c
    • 在输出中找到包含PASSWORD的行,该行的密码字段即为Oracle Database的密码。

请注意,以上方法仅适用于默认安装和配置的情况,实际情况可能因服务器环境和配置而有所不同。在生产环境中,保护数据库密码的安全非常重要,建议采取安全措施,如限制访问权限、加密存储等。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的合辑

领券